A new publication involving GHK-Cu was released on November 1, 2026. The paper, titled "Hierarchical regulation and mechanism of 'open-hollow-fibrous network' structures: Osteogenic-angiogenic coupling responses of poly(γ-benzyl-L-glutamate) microspheres," appeared in the journal Biomaterials Advances.

The publication is indexed under PubMed ID 42320090. It is described as examining hierarchical regulation and mechanisms related to open-hollow-fibrous network structures in poly(γ-benzyl-L-glutamate) microspheres, with a focus on osteogenic-angiogenic coupling responses.
